Inn at Diamond Cove Review: Portland Maine Island Hotel

Summary by shebuystravel.com
I’ve visited Portland several times as my primary destination and as a pit stop on Maine road trips. Usually, I stay downtown in the Old Port neighborhood so I can walk to the city’s celebrated restaurants. On a recent trip, however, I stayed at The Inn at Diamond Cove, a boutique hotel in a converted military barracks on a car-free island in Casco Bay. My adult son and I explored the island’s coves and alternated swimming with napping poolside.…
